Easy Pecan Pie

Pecan Pie Recipe


  • Author: Patricia
  • Total Time: 60 minutes
  • Yield: 1 pie (8 servings) 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A simple and delicious pecan pie with a gooey texture and nutty crunch.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up sugar - Adds sweetness and helps form the pie’s gooey texture.
  • 3 eggs - Provide structure and richness.
  • 2 tbsp butter (melted) - Adds flavor and a silky texture.
  • 1 cup corn syrup (light or dark) - Light for a delicate sweetness, dark for a deeper caramel flavor.
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ract - Enhances all the other flavors.
  • 1 deep frozen pie crust - Saves time without sacrificing taste.
  • 6.5 oz package of pecan pieces or halves - Gives the pie its signature crunch and nutty flavor.

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large bowl, mix sugar, eggs, melted butter, corn syrup,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  3. Pour the mixture into the frozen pie crust.
  4. Arrange the pecan pieces or halves evenly over the top.
  5. Bake for 45-50 minutes or until the filling is set.
  6. Let the pie cool before serving.

Notes

  • Use light corn syrup for a milder flavor or dark for a richer taste.
  • Check the pie after 40 minutes to avoid overbaking.
  • Let the pie cool completely for easier slicing.
